The federal government is halving its discount on the fuel excise after three months of providing relief to motorists. The Albanese government is welcoming a drop in global prices but is still extending its measures to ease economic pressure at the bowser for another month. ABC reporter Isabella Tolhurst says the cut to its discount is likely to lead to a slight increase in petrol prices.
